草庐IT

java - 需要更改什么才能成功将 spring-data-redis 1.8.15 的 XML 配置移动到 2.1.0?

我正在尝试将使用spring-data-redis1.8.15.RELEASE的现有应用程序更新到2.1.0。发布。此应用程序使用基于XML的配置并且是在SpringBoot之前创建的,因此我无法使用利用更现代的Spring和SpringBoot配置代码的文档。在更改spring-data-redis的版本之前,应用能够编译运行成功,使用redis有多种用途,包括spring-session。但是,在更新spring-data-redis的版​​本之后,当我尝试运行该应用程序时,我收到一个异常,告诉我JedisConnectionFactorybean无法再被实例化。从文档(https

php - 慢查询 WordPress 网站(每月 50 万访问者和 15 万个帖子)

我正在运行一个每月有50万访问者和15万个帖子的WordPress网站,平均每秒有100次页面浏览。我想弄清楚服务器上的负载是否正常,或者我是否可以做些什么来解决性能问题而不增加服务器设置和每月成本。这是我现在正在运行的服务器设置:2个前端服务器,Nginx:2个CPU和4GBRAM1个数据库服务器,MariaDB:8个CPU和16GB内存1个Redis服务器:2个CPU和4GBRAMWordPress主题是从头开始开发的,我优化了查询并最大限度地减少了插件的使用(总共5个插件)。我运行带反向代理缓存的Nginx,我将所有页面缓存5分钟,以便能够处理流量高峰(每天两次高峰,在发送时事通

MySQL LIMIT 0,15 其中 15 是 parent_ids 的数量,不是 child

我有一张表,我正在尝试为ajax分页获取评论。你可以在这里看到一个SQLFiddle:http://sqlfiddle.com/#!2/5d36a/1但基本上,如果没有0,15的LIMIT,它会按预期工作:例如所有子评论都将与父评论一起显示/显示在父评论下方。当我引入LIMIT时问题就来了。在上面的例子中,它会获取15条评论,但是因为第16条评论是id=6的评论的子评论,所以它不会被返回。如果将其更改为LIMIT0,16,它将正确返回。基本上我一次只想返回0,15个父评论,但不限制子评论。有人告诉我尝试一个临时表,但后来有人告诉我它可能更简单(并且只使用一个带有内部选择的连接),但我有

mysql - 删除所有超过 15 分钟的条目

我有一个表,每分钟大约有10-15k个条目。每一个都在输入时标有当前时间戳。该表是一个MEMORY表,因为丢失数据不是问题。每一分钟,我都有一个运行以下查询的脚本:DELETEFROMtrackerWHEREpost_time此查询运行大约需要1-2秒,这还不错,但似乎这种类型的查询(删除所有早于X的内容)应该能够执行得更快针对MEMORY表运行时。它也有一个相应的CPU峰值,每分钟都会像拇指一样突出。是否可以对我的查询进行任何优化以更有效地运行此查询? 最佳答案 与往常一样,您应该查看查询计划,并将其张贴在这里。您可以通过发出EX

mysql - 如何修复由于未加载 libmysqlclient.15.dylib 而导致的错误?

我已经升级到Rails2.2.2并安装了MySQL2.7gem,当我尝试运行迁移或启动服务器时看到这个错误:dlopen(/Library/Ruby/Gems/1.8/gems/mysql-2.7/lib/mysql.bundle,9):Librarynotloaded:/usr/local/mysql/lib/mysql/libmysqlclient.15.dylibReferencedfrom:/Library/Ruby/Gems/1.8/gems/mysql-2.7/lib/mysql.bundleReason:imagenotfound-/Library/Ruby/Gems/1

ios - 这 15 个 apple mach o 链接器错误是什么意思

还有这个:Ld/Users/davidraijmakers/Library/Developer/Xcode/DerivedData/Scanner-bbwbbvayxxnrhwdsgbkvibplofyw/Build/Products/Debug-iphoneos/Scanner.app/Scannernormalarmv7cd/Users/davidraijmakers/Documents/xcodezooi/ScannersetenvIPHONEOS_DEPLOYMENT_TARGET6.0setenvPATH"/Applications/Xcode.app/Contents/De

iphone - 如何根据当前日期获取下一个 15 天的日期?

目前我可以使用以下代码获取iPhone的当前日期NSDate*date=[NSDatedate];NSDateFormatter*formatter=[[NSDateFormatteralloc]init];[formattersetDateFormat:@"yyyy-MM-dd"];NSString*currentDateStr=[formatterstringFromDate:date];NSLog(@"User'scurrentDate:%@",currentDateStr);但我想获取从当前日期算起的下一个15天的日期,我该如何获取? 最佳答案

ios - 重要的位置变化不会至少每 15 分钟触发一次

根据apple文档,重要的位置更改应至少每15分钟更新一次位置。当我大幅移动时,我确实会收到更新,但当设备静止时则不会。您对更新有何体验?他们至少每15分钟来一次吗?IfGPS-levelaccuracyisn’tcriticalforyourappandyoudon’tneedcontinuoustracking,youcanusethesignificant-changelocationservice.It’scrucialthatyouusethesignificant-changelocationservicecorrectly,becauseitwakesthesystema

ios - CALayer 位置包含 NaN : [nan 15]

我的iPhone应用程序崩溃并显示错误***Terminatingappduetouncaughtexception'CALayerInvalidGeometry',reason:'CALayerpositioncontainsNaN:[nan15]'这是什么意思? 最佳答案 “CALayerpositioncontainsNaN:[nan15]”表示某处被零除。NSLog()将帮助您隔离它。如果您发布堆栈日志,将会获得更多帮助。 关于ios-CALayer位置包含NaN:[nan15]

ios - 由于使用不到 15MB 的内存压力而终止

我遇到了一个奇怪的问题,我正在开发的应用程序由于内存压力而不断被终止,但它并没有像您在屏幕截图中看到的那样真正使用太多。所以我开始寻找“其他”问题,如内存泄漏、隐式转换,但我真的不知道如何调试这类事情,所以...有人知道如何解决这个问题吗?:) 最佳答案 通常由于内存压力而终止当应用程序被iOS本身挂起时发生。当您的设备没有大量可用内存时会发生这种情况,这通常是一个好兆头(这意味着当用户关闭您的应用程序时迟早会发生这种情况)。我建议您使用Instruments并找到您的应用程序的确切终止位置(如果是这种情况)。好的Instrumen